Which Style Of Ballroom Dancing Should You Learn

So you are inspired by the TV dancing reality shows Dancing with the Stars and So You Think You Can Dance and is seeking information about how to learn ballroom dancing.

Ballroom dancing is very popular all over the world because it appeals to people of various ages and is a fantastic form of exercise keeping you fit, healthy and in great shape. On the social aspect, you can spend quality time with like minded people who are ballroom dancing fans just like you are.

Ballroom dancing is a very wide terminology and is used to refer to the many styles of dancing with a partner on the dance floor. Some of the more common ballroom dance styles are the Waltz, Salsa, Tango, Foxtrot, Lindy Hop, The Jive, Cha Cha and Rhumba amongst many others.

Many forms of this dance originated from different cultures and nationalities. As such, if you decide to take up dance lessons, then you should choose between programs that offer the basics or programs which are based on the customs and styles of different cultures. For this, you can do your research on the internet and to read and watch the different dance forms before choosing one of your choice.

Ballroom dancing lessons are typically taught in group classes or in private lessons and thus it is important to decide which format you prefer before you start approaching dance lesson studios. If you are interested in the dances to learn the basic techniques and also as a social activity such as making new friends, then group lessons could be what you are looking for.

However, dance classes lessons will not be as intensive and as elborate as private lessons. This is because private lessons offer you the opportunities to hone and perfect the various dance techniques and to work on specific styles and aspect of the moves of the various dance forms. Private lessons are also excellent for dancers who want to choreograph a dance style for performances at some social functions such as weddings and parties or even to join contests.

If you intend to take up lessons, then you should visit several studios to watch how lessons are being conducted instead of enrolling in one immediately. This is because you need to find out if you are comfortable in the dance studio, if the instructors are credible, which dance style the the classes are focusing on and other matters that you should know that is particular to you.

If you find that dancing classes or private lessons are out of your budget or the location of the classes are inconvenient or you can t commit to fixed schedules for your lessons, then the alternative is to look for dancing lessons in the form of DVDs or multi media instructions. There are now many great dancing coaches offering dance instructions in the form of DVDs or online coaching.

That being the case, you can find pre recorded lessons or online lessons from well respected credible international coaches at the price of several DVDs and can learn ballroom dancing from the comfort of your home together with your favorite dance partner.
